658
659 /* The firmware interface is, um, interesting, in that the
660 * actual firmware image on the chip is little endian, thus,
661 * the process of taking that image to the CPU would end up
c3af1715 662 * little endian. However, the firmware interface requires it
1da177e4
LT
663 * to be read a word (two bytes) at a time.
664 *
665 * The net result of this would be that the word (and
666 * doubleword) quantites in the firmware would be correct, but
667 * the bytes would be pairwise reversed. Since most of the
668 * firmware quantites are, in fact, bytes, we do an extra
669 * le16_to_cpu() in the firmware read routine.
670 *
671 * The upshot of all this is that the bytes in the firmware
672 * are in the correct places, but the 16 and 32 bit quantites
673 * are still in little endian format. We fix that up below by
674 * doing extra reverses on them */
675 nv->isp_parameter = cpu_to_le16(nv->isp_parameter);
676 nv->firmware_feature.w = cpu_to_le16(nv->firmware_feature.w);
677 for(i = 0; i < MAX_BUSES; i++) {
678 nv->bus[i].selection_timeout = cpu_to_le16(nv->bus[i].selection_timeout);
679 nv->bus[i].max_queue_depth = cpu_to_le16(nv->bus[i].max_queue_depth);
680 }
681 dprintk(1, "qla1280_read_nvram: Completed Reading NVRAM\n");
682 LEAVE("qla1280_read_nvram");
683
684 return chksum;
685}

3354 } else
3355 ha->request_ring_ptr++;
3356
3357 /*
3358 * Update request index to mailbox4 (Request Queue In).
3359 * The mmiowb() ensures that this write is ordered with writes by other
3360 * CPUs. Without the mmiowb(), it is possible for the following:
3361 * CPUA posts write of index 5 to mailbox4
3362 * CPUA releases host lock
3363 * CPUB acquires host lock
3364 * CPUB posts write of index 6 to mailbox4
3365 * On PCI bus, order reverses and write of 6 posts, then index 5,
3366 * causing chip to issue full queue of stale commands
3367 * The mmiowb() prevents future writes from crossing the barrier.
3368 * See Documentation/DocBook/deviceiobook.tmpl for more information.
3369 */
3370 WRT_REG_WORD(&reg->mailbox4, ha->req_ring_index);
3371 mmiowb();
3372
3373 LEAVE("qla1280_isp_cmd");
3374}
